🧠A UK Member of Parliament has filed a lawsuit against xAI over a deepfake bikini image allegedly created by the Grok chatbot, raising significant questions about AI accountability and content moderation. The case is expected to establish important legal precedents regarding privacy rights, data protection, and the liability of AI companies for non-consensual intimate imagery generated by their systems.

🤖xAI is seeking to unmask anonymous plaintiffs in a lawsuit alleging that its Grok AI system generated non-consensual deepfake content, including of a minor victim. The legal move raises concerns about whether victims may be deterred from pursuing accountability if their identities are publicly disclosed.

🧠Florida has filed a lawsuit against OpenAI and Sam Altman regarding ChatGPT safety and alleged user harm, potentially establishing new legal precedent for AI company liability. The case could significantly increase regulatory scrutiny and reshape how AI products are marketed and governed.

⛓️An Idaho retired couple is suing Bitcoin Depot after losing $76,000 in life savings to scammers who allegedly exploited the company's ATM network. The lawsuit highlights vulnerabilities in cryptocurrency ATM security and customer protection mechanisms, raising questions about operational safeguards at major Bitcoin ATM operators.

🧠CNN has sued Perplexity, alleging the AI startup's search engine generates verbatim copies of its news content and provides access to paywalled articles without permission. The lawsuit claims Perplexity ignored CNN's crawler-blocking efforts while profiting from human-created journalism without compensation.

🧠A plaintiff attempting to sue Facebook users for negative comments in an 'Are We Dating the Same Guy' group relied on AI-generated fake legal citations, which were discovered and dismissed by the court. The case highlights the dangers of using AI tools without proper verification in legal proceedings and underscores growing concerns about AI-generated misinformation in formal legal contexts.

📰Krispy Kreme has agreed to pay $1.6 million to settle a class action lawsuit stemming from a data breach affecting 161,676 current and former employees. Affected individuals could receive up to $3,500 each in compensation for exposure of their sensitive personal information.
